YraggarY wrote: » That's awful! I'm so enraged that this can and does happen in today's society! I know its got nothing to do with the North East region but it happened to a friend of mine in a Dublin nightclub as well. She was given a drink of vodka and blackcurrant, took a sip, realised she shouldn't have and pretended to drink the rest whilst pouring it out. She felt somewhat light-headed, and had her friends there to look after her. Both they and she noticed that she was being watched by the two men who approached her with the drink. Approximately 83,000 pills of flunitrazepam were recently stolen from a pharmaceutical company in Dublin. Flunitrazepam is commonly marketed under the product name Rohypnol. The story is http://www.rte.ie/news/2009/0512/drugs.html there. I can only second pullandbang's advice; be careful out there. Don't accept drinks from strange people, or indeed, acquaintances. Stay safe. Apologies to the mods for the off-forum nature of the post, but I felt compelled to add another warning here.. - Gary
